Your monthly costs vary depending on your state, your provider, and the policy you choose. On average, most Medicare Plan G premiums will be between $100-$200 per month.
What is the Plan G deductible in 2024? $240 the annual Part B deductible in 2024 is what you will pay for your Plan G deductible. However, Plan G does not have its own deductible separate from the Part B deductible. There is also a High Deductible Plan G which has a deductible of $2,800 in 2024.
Best Medicare Supplement Plan G in Michigan. Priority Health is the best insurer that offers Medigap Plan G in Michigan. On average, a policy from Priority Health costs $127.19 per month.
Statewide, 22% of the total population is enrolled in Medicare. Total Medicare enrollment is approximately 2.21 million with 61% of beneficiaries enrolled in a Medicare Advantage (MA) plan. MA enrollment as a percentage of total Medicare enrollment varies by county, ranging from 45% to 76%.

Plan F, Plan G and Plan N are the most popular types of Medicare Supplement plans. Medicare Supplement Plan F is the most comprehensive Medigap option available, providing beneficiaries with 100% coverage of Medicare-covered medical expenses after Original Medicare pays its portion.
Medicare Plan G out-of-pocket costs and maximums With a Plan G, your out-of-pocket costs for covered services are reduced to just your annual Part B deductible ($240 in 2024). Theres no out-of-pocket maximum for Plan G because costs are reduced in a way that its not necessary.
Plans F and G are the most popular and comprehensive Medigap plan types in Michigan. Plan F is no longer available to people who are eligible for Medicare after December 31, 2019. Monthly premiums for Plan G for a 65 year old female who doesnt use tobacco range from $106 to $343.
